Audio file cannot be played back.
• USB devices formatted with file 
systems other than FAT16 or FAT32 are 
unsupported.*
• A WMA audio file that is the WMA 
DRM, WMA Lossless, or WMA PRO 
format cannot be played back.
• An AAC audio file that is the AAC 
DRM or AAC Lossless format cannot 
be played back.
• AAC audio files encoded at 96 kHz 
cannot be played back.
• If multiple partitions exist on a USB 
device that is being used, files may not 
be played back.
• The system can play back to a depth of 
8 folders only.
• Files that are encrypted or protected by 
passwords cannot be played back.
• Files with DRM (Digital Rights 
Management) copyright protection 
cannot be played back by this system. 
• The MP3 PRO audio file can be played 
back as MP3 audio file.
* This system supports FAT16 and FAT32, but 
some USB devices may not support all of 
these FAT. For details, refer to the operating 
instructions of each USB device or contact the 
manufacturer.
Tuner
There is severe hum or noise, or 
stations cannot be received. 
(“TUNED” or “ST” flashes in the 
display panel.)
• Connect the antenna properly.
• Change the antenna location and its 
orientation to obtain good reception.
• Connect a commercially available 
external antenna.
• Consult your nearest Sony dealer if the 
supplied AM antenna has come off from 
the plastic stand.
• Turn off surrounding electrical 
equipment.
Bluetooth device
Pairing cannot be performed.
• Move the Bluetooth device closer to the 
system.
• Pairing may not be possible if other 
Bluetooth devices are present around the 
system. In this case, turn off the other 
Bluetooth devices.
• Make sure the correct passkey was 
entered at the Bluetooth device.
The Bluetooth device cannot detect 
this unit, or “BT OFF” appears in the 
display panel.
• Set the Bluetooth signal to “BT ON” 
Connection is not possible.
• The Bluetooth device you attempted to 
connect does not support the A2DP 
profile, and cannot be connected with 
the system.
• Enable the Bluetooth function of the 
Bluetooth device.
• Establish a connection from the 
Bluetooth device.
• The pairing registration information has 
been erased. Perform the pairing 
operation again.
• While connected to a Bluetooth device, 
this system cannot be detected and a 
connection cannot be established from 
another Bluetooth device which is never 
paired before.
• Erase the pairing registration 
information of the Bluetooth device 
(page 27) and perform the pairing 
operation again (page 25).
